refactor: unify model_type semantics by introducing sub_type field
This commit resolves the semantic confusion around the model_type field by clearly distinguishing between: - scanner_type: architecture-level (lora/checkpoint/embedding) - sub_type: business-level subtype (lora/locon/dora/checkpoint/diffusion_model/embedding) Backend Changes: - Rename model_type to sub_type in CheckpointMetadata and EmbeddingMetadata - Add resolve_sub_type() and normalize_sub_type() in model_query.py - Update checkpoint_scanner to use _resolve_sub_type() - Update service format_response to include both sub_type and model_type - Add VALID_*_SUB_TYPES constants with backward compatible aliases Frontend Changes: - Add MODEL_SUBTYPE_DISPLAY_NAMES constants - Keep MODEL_TYPE_DISPLAY_NAMES as backward compatible alias Testing: - Add 43 new tests covering sub_type resolution and API response Documentation: - Add refactoring todo document to docs/technical/ BREAKING CHANGE: None - full backward compatibility maintained
